Gentle Cognitive Impairment: The Middle Ground

Gentle Cognitive Impairment occupies a space amongst the predicted cognitive variations of ordinary aging and the more severe decline of dementia. Consider it like a gray zone – obvious adjustments that don't substantially interfere with lifestyle.

In case you have MCI, you would possibly battle to recollect latest conversations or appointments. Maybe you find it harder to generate selections or Adhere to the plot of the movie. Close relatives may possibly observe these alterations, but typically, you'll be able to nevertheless handle your funds, acquire your drugs, prepare foods, and retain your house.

What helps make MCI various from regular aging would be that the improvements are increased than anticipated for somebody of your respective age and schooling level. Having said that, compared with Alzheimer's ailment, these adjustments don't very seriously compromise your independence or capacity to function in day-to-day routines.

The various Faces of MCI

Not all Gentle Cognitive Impairment is identical. Health professionals acknowledge differing kinds depending on which wondering capabilities are afflicted:

Amnestic MCI mostly has an effect on memory. You could ignore critical events, conversations, or appointments that you would probably previously have remembered.

Non-amnestic MCI influences considering capabilities other than memory. You may have issues with planning, organizing, generating seem judgments, or navigating familiar areas.

A lot of people experience several sorts of MCI, influencing each memory along with other cognitive features. The precise sample can offer clues about the underlying result in and if the affliction could possibly development to dementia.

Alzheimer's Disease: When Cognitive Modifications Disrupt Lifestyle

Alzheimer's condition is the most typical sort of dementia, accounting for sixty-80% of situations. Contrary to MCI, Alzheimer's noticeably interferes with day by day functioning and independence.

In the early levels of Alzheimer's, memory problems are often more pronounced than with MCI. You may repeat concerns, get lost in common sites, or have hassle managing income and paying out payments. Because the illness progresses, modifications in personality and actions may well produce. You could possibly grow to be puzzled, suspicious, or withdrawn, and possess problem with language, dilemma-solving, and common jobs.

What distinguishes Alzheimer's from MCI may be the impact on everyday life. With Alzheimer's, cognitive adjustments ultimately enable it to be challenging to control independently, and assistance will become needed for activities which were as soon as regime.

The Science Driving the Symptoms

Both equally situations contain alterations within the Mind, but to various levels.

In MCI, brain scans might exhibit moderate shrinkage in memory centers just like the hippocampus. There may be tiny accumulations of irregular proteins referred to as amyloid plaques and tau tangles – the hallmarks of Alzheimer's illness – but in lesser amounts.

In Alzheimer's disorder, these brain improvements get more info are more prevalent and severe. The plaques and tangles spread throughout the brain, disrupting interaction involving neurons and sooner or later triggering mobile Loss of life. After a while, the brain basically shrinks noticeably, impacting nearly all its features.

The Progression Issue: Will MCI Result in Alzheimer's?

Just about the most common questions on MCI is whether it is going to development to Alzheimer's condition. The solution is not simple.

Some individuals with MCI keep on being secure For some time without the need of sizeable worsening. Other folks may well even see their signs or symptoms strengthen, particularly when their cognitive changes were being because of medication side effects, rest complications, or mood Conditions that can be addressed.

Nonetheless, investigate suggests that about 10-fifteen% of those with MCI go on to develop dementia every year, compared to 1-2% of the final more mature Grownup population. About a span of five years, about 30-fifty% of those with MCI may possibly progress to Alzheimer's illness or An additional form of dementia.

Certain things may possibly boost the possibility of development. These contain obtaining the amnestic sort of MCI, carrying unique genetic variants such as the APOE e4 gene, displaying individual styles on Mind scans, or getting irregular amounts of specific proteins in spinal fluid.

Treating Memory Problems: Unique Approaches for various Situations

The remedy ways for MCI and Alzheimer's illness replicate their distinctions in severity and impact.

For MCI, there are actually at the moment no remedies precisely accredited for remedy. As an alternative, administration focuses on addressing risk components Which may worsen cognitive operate, such as significant hypertension, diabetic issues, large cholesterol, despair, rest Problems, and drugs Uncomfortable side effects.

Life-style interventions Participate in an important role in MCI administration. Common Bodily training, cognitive stimulation, social engagement, a Mediterranean-design diet program, and good management of other overall health conditions might support maintain cognitive operate and most likely slow progression.

For Alzheimer's ailment, treatment method features medicines which could briefly strengthen symptoms or slow ailment development. These include cholinesterase inhibitors (like donepezil, rivastigmine, and galantamine) and memantine. While these remedies Never halt the fundamental Mind modifications, they're able to support manage functionality and quality of life to get a time frame.

As Alzheimer's improvements, cure significantly concentrates on managing behavioral signs and symptoms and delivering proper care and assist to take care of dignity and Standard of living.
